125 _dbus_pthread_mutex_lock (DBusMutex *mutex)
127 DBusMutexPThread *pmutex = DBUS_MUTEX_PTHREAD (mutex);
128 pthread_t self = pthread_self ();
130 /* If the count is > 0 then someone had the lock, maybe us. If it is
131 * 0, then it might immediately change right after we read it,
132 * but it will be changed by another thread; i.e. if we read 0,
133 * we assume that this thread doesn't have the lock.
135 * Not 100% sure this is safe, but ... seems like it should be.
137 if (pmutex->count == 0)
139 /* We know we don't have the lock; someone may have the lock. */
141 PTHREAD_CHECK ("pthread_mutex_lock", pthread_mutex_lock (&pmutex->lock));
143 /* We now have the lock. Count must be 0 since it must be 0 when
144 * the lock is released by another thread, and we just now got
147 _dbus_assert (pmutex->count == 0);
149 pmutex->holder = self;
154 /* We know someone had the lock, possibly us. Thus
155 * pmutex->holder is not pointing to junk, though it may not be
156 * the lock holder anymore if the lock holder is not us. If the
157 * lock holder is us, then we definitely have the lock.
160 if (pthread_equal (pmutex->holder, self))
162 /* We already have the lock. */
163 _dbus_assert (pmutex->count > 0);
167 /* Wait for the lock */
168 PTHREAD_CHECK ("pthread_mutex_lock", pthread_mutex_lock (&pmutex->lock));
169 pmutex->holder = self;
170 _dbus_assert (pmutex->count == 0);
178 _dbus_pthread_mutex_unlock (DBusMutex *mutex)
180 DBusMutexPThread *pmutex = DBUS_MUTEX_PTHREAD (mutex);
182 _dbus_assert (pmutex->count > 0);
186 if (pmutex->count == 0)
187 PTHREAD_CHECK ("pthread_mutex_unlock", pthread_mutex_unlock (&pmutex->lock));
189 /* We leave pmutex->holder set to ourselves, its content is undefined if count is 0 */
